If your cloud provider, web builder, or PaaS use a unique subdomain like krabby-kitten-1234.the-cloud.com create an ALIAS Record for host @ and that subdomain as the value. If you have an IP address instead, create an A Record for host @ with the IP address as the value. Finally, create a CNAME Record with host www and value https://example.com. - Source: dev.to / 5 days ago

Svelte is an open source JavaScript framework which gains popularity among web developers due to its fast client performance (compared to React and Vue), lightweight nature and ease of learning. Svelte, together with SvelteKit, makes web developers more productive allowing them to build projects faster, write code that is easier to understand and fix, and simply "code with joy". - Source: dev.to / 22 days ago
